Deploy step 4 — Gridloader CSV Wizard. Pull the release tag, run migrations, clear the parser cache. Copy env.sample to .env in the wizard root and set the upload size limit. Do not start the worker yet. Place the import-service secret on the next line.

sealed setting: VAULT_KEY20=c8ea1e419912889df6b4

Subject: Handover — FD leak hunt, week of the Marrow release

Hi, taking over from me on the leaked-file-descriptor hunt in the Quillon gateway: repro steps are in the runbook, and the instrumented build is staged. You'll need to push the instrumented build yourself through the Tarnley deploy lane. Deploys there must be signed with this key:

rollout seal: bky9_aBG1gvAyU

Deep links into the Ferngate app are routed by the `linkmap` service, which resolves each inbound URL to a screen identifier before the client navigates. If a link opens the home screen instead of the expected view, check the linkmap resolution logs first, as misrouted links are almost always mapping gaps. To request a new mapping, contact the routing team at the address below.

escalation mailbox, bafog-fafog: ulador@paliqlabs.internal